Deloitte’s 2023 Health Care Consumer survey polled 2,014 US adults and found that one-half overall felt that AI had the potential to improve access to care (such as lowering wait times for appointments), and nearly one-half so said AI could improve affordability in the form of lowering individuals’ health care costs.
